Transaction 590ffd7b88789e7641cc49ff670f2f344d6a99fc34ff3a9000cd743801fdedbc

2 Input
1 Outputs
  • 590ffd7b88789e7641cc49ff670f2f344d6a99fc34ff3a9000cd743801fdedbc:0
  • value  759852
    address  1L3pTrupz8tsdFrfRiouWHS9LvLgNeGMLB